(2019)[前端]面试题[1]:小知识点大集合

问题 这里集合一下小的、杂碎的知识点。 Hello,欢迎来到我的博客,每天一道面试题,我们共同进步。 1.CSS属性是否区分大小写? 答:不区分,(HTML, CSS都不区分,但为了更好的可读性和团队协作,一般都小写,而在XHTML 中元素名称和属性是必须小写的。) 2.对行内元素设置margintop 和marginbottom是否起作用 答:不起作用
2019-10-07 21:59 前端相关 0 人评

PHP等比缩放图片大小并转换格式

背景介绍 我的一个项目需要调用一个接口上传图片,但是该接口对图像大小有一定要求,图片格式还必须是jpg。偏偏给我的原图像这两个要求都不满足。 弄了一下午了,其实也简单。 解决 代码 php <?php function resizeImage($srcImage, $per, $name) { list($widt
2019-10-06 15:34 编程相关 0 人评

(2019)[前端]面试题[8]:CSS动画中的transition和animation

问题 > CSS动画中的transition和animation Hello,欢迎来到我的博客,每天一道面试题,我们共同进步。 解答 CSS中和动画有关的属性有两种:transition和animation 其中animation和关键帧配合使用【@keyframes】 transition 我们先来看一个简单例子: html
2019-10-05 09:39 前端相关 0 人评

【懒盘】全新网盘密码自动填取脚本

本篇文章需要密码来阅读
2019-10-04 19:08 编程相关 5 人评

(2019)[前端]面试题[7]:CSS中权重计算方式方法

问题 > CSS中的选择器权重 Hello,欢迎来到我的博客,每天一道面试题,我们共同进步。 解答 不用说,CSS权重肯定是面试中最常考的题之一。 我们直接上权重计算规则: 1. 第零等:important,是觉得的大佬,排第一。 2. 第一等:代表内联样式,如: style=””,权值为1000。 3. 第二等:代表ID选择器,如:con
2019-10-03 20:43 前端相关 0 人评

(2019)[前端]面试题[6]:水平垂直居中方法

问题 > 水平垂直居中的实现方式,尽可能多 Hello,欢迎来到我的博客,每天一道面试题,我们共同进步。 解答 > 这个有很多方法,我们一个个来说。 方法一:absoulte transform(此方法未知子元素宽度) 截图1570018445(https://wimg.misiyu.cn/images/20191002/1570018
2019-10-02 20:29 前端相关 0 人评

(2019)[前端]面试题[5]:CSS单位那些事【px,em,rem】

问题 > 说一下你了解的CSS的单位? Hello,欢迎来到我的博客,每天一道面试题,我们共同进步。 解答 首先CSS长度单位分为【绝对长度单位】和【相对长度单位】 绝对长度单位 in 英寸 cm 厘米 mm 毫米 pt pc 结论: 绝对长度单位表示为一个固定的值,不会改变。不利于页面渲染。所以很少人用。 相对长度单
2019-10-01 20:10 前端相关 0 人评

CentOS7下安装Sphinx 中文分词【PHP+MySQL】

前言 Mysql 的搜索,只能很简单的like '%无道%',那显然是远远不够的。只能找第三方的服务。 国内有 讯搜(http://www.xunsearch.com/),国外有 Sphinx(http://sphinxsearch.com/) 最终选择了Sphinx Sphinx官网:http://sphinxsearch.com/ 阅读本文需要:
2019-10-01 15:00 教程相关 0 人评

(2019)[前端]面试题[4]:CSS盒模型你了解多少?

问题 1、请谈谈你对盒模型的认识 2、Bootstrap默认全局使用什么盒模型 2、你知道盒模型模型有哪些(2种)?【W3C盒子模型(标准模型盒)、IE盒子模型】 Hello,欢迎来到我的博客,每天一道面试题,我们共同进步。 絮叨 你以为盒模型知识点很简单?稍微了解多一点,都会觉得,这些知识点都是真的多。 泪(https://wi
2019-09-30 20:09 前端相关 0 人评

(2019)[前端]面试题[3]:三大定位,相对定位放在固定定位产生什么影响?

问题 > 三大定位,相对定位放在固定定位产生什么影响? Hello,欢迎来到我的博客,每天一道面试题,我们共同进步。 前提 前面文章已经说过了,相对定位和固定定位,都会使块级元素产生BFC。 https://www.misiyu.cn/article/96.html 解答 1、设置父元素为固定定位,不设置高度,内部child设置
2019-09-29 19:41 前端相关 0 人评

还得再来聊聊Laravel中的对多对模型的一些事

前言 之前,在文章:https://www.misiyu.cn/article/58.html 已经发过关于Laravel中的多对多关系了。 但回过头来,过了个把月再去看,我自己都忘了怎么写了。 确实看laravel的中文文档,看得糊里糊涂的。还是得在实践中理解啊。 情景假设 我有一张来源表(referers)来记录href和网页标题tit
2019-09-29 11:05 编程相关 0 人评

(2019)[前端]面试题[2]:清除浮动的方式

Hello,欢迎来到我的博客,每天一道面试题,我们共同进步。 问题 清除浮动的方式 前提 什么是浮动 我们首先得明白什么是浮动:在较早的时候,那时候布局是没有现在的flex之流的。那个时候比较流行的是浮动布局:float。但是用了之后,是可以解决一些布局问题,但又带来了其他问题了。 普通情况下父元素高度由子元素高度决定: 截图1569663230(
2019-09-28 17:48 前端相关 0 人评

(2019)[前端]面试题[1]:CSS BFC是什么【BFC详解】

Hello,欢迎来到我的博客,每天一道面试题,我们共同进步。 问题 CSS BFC是什么? 解答 定义 BFC(Block Formatting Context)格式化上下文,是盒模型的一种渲染布局,简言之可以理解为 一个独立的容器,不受外部影响,不影响外部。 形成条件 1. 固定(fixed)定位和绝对(absolute)定位 2.
2019-09-27 20:13 前端相关 0 人评

Tampermonkey 本地开发【使用$.ajax】 http被禁止解决方法

背景描述 在本地开发Tampermonkey(油猴)脚本,其中需要和本地服务器交互,但是运行的网站是https,本地服务器是http,请求被谷歌浏览器禁止了。 截图1569549911(https://wimg.misiyu.cn/images/20190927/1569549912b7ba1237ffc5a25.png?xossprocess=style/misiyu) 以
2019-09-27 10:10 编程相关 0 人评

Laravel6.0中提示不能创建临时文件:无权限

2019年11月16日更新 找到解决办法了: 1、修改php.ini的配置文件,找到systempdir项,如果前面有:;,记得去除。 2、默认systempdir是/tmp,这在Windows上是C:\tmp,这也是不能提示创建的原因。我们可以修改到其它盘去,比如我这里是F:\logs 截图1573872562(https://wimg.misiyu.cn/images
2019-09-24 19:10 编程相关 0 人评

Laravel 解决跨域[COS]问题【附CSRF问题】

前言 越发觉得发博客是一种好的习惯,因为自己经历过这种坑,影响深刻。并且所附上的解决办法是真实有效的。没办法,哪些csdn之流的,转载来转载去,不能说没用,但很多都失效或过期了。 还有一个好处是:不记录下,就比如现在的我,还要打开以前的项目去看怎么解决的。这比打开博客一搜慢多了。 细节 创建一个中间件 EnableCrossRequestMidd
2019-09-23 20:50 编程相关 0 人评

Node.js中利用multiparty处理表单

前言 如果你的node.js中未使用框架来开发一个后台,那么如何处理表单数据可能有很多方法。经过实践我觉得利用multiparty这个类库来处理表单数据可能是一个比较好的想法。 因为表单数据大致有两种: 普通表单数据 表单文件上传 细节 安装 bash npm i multiparty S 表单 html <
2019-09-22 12:34 NodeJs 0 人评

自己原生js封装的ajax请求

前言 这几天在恶(xue)补(xi)node.js,其中老师讲到了ajax,以前学习js都是东一点、西一点。不系统,当然,原因也很多。 当时一些js基础知识也欠缺(虽然现在也不咋的),想要自己封装,难度也很大。 今天也终于自己封装一个简易 的ajax。 细节 发送POST数据,需要设置header头: 将 ContentType 头部
2019-09-20 15:24 前端相关 0 人评

关于正则优先级踩的坑【匹配图片后缀结尾】

前言 其实之前还真没注意到正则表达式总还有“优先级”这一说法。不过平常注意一下就可以了【踩过一次坑之后自然就会记住了~】。 采坑 一个很简单的应用:验证图片后缀是否允许。 javascript let a = '1.jpg'; console.log(/\.gif|png|jpg$/i.test(a)); 截图1568798151(https:
2019-09-18 17:21 编程相关 0 人评

关于ES6中的模块化的规范:export与import

前言 其实对我个人来说,开始的时候对于export 与 import 用法挺模糊的。到现在为止也终于清楚一点了。 有一些前提我们需要了解清楚: 1、JS以前是没有模块化这个概念的,没有的后果就是代码显得较乱。后来社区出现了两种规范:CommonJS、AMD 2、对于我来说,问题出现就出现在这两个规范上,由于没有系统的学习,一会import 一会export
2019-09-17 19:09 NodeJs 0 人评